Which option describes cohesion in writing?(1 point)
providing reasons for a claim
including details that support an idea
drawing conclusions based on facts
the act of forming a logical whole
All Answers 1
Answered by
GPT-5 mini
AI
the act of forming a logical whole
Cohesion refers to how parts of a text connect and flow together to create a unified, logical whole (using transitions, pronouns, conjunctions, etc.).
